Rey Mysterio: No Escape begins with the early life of Oscar Gutierrez, later known as Rey Mysterio Jr., a young boy who was born in San Diego, California, but raised in Chula Vista near the US-Mexico border. This environment had a profound impact on Oscar's life, being surrounded by the vibrant and energetic Mexican culture that seeped into every aspect of his daily existence. Growing up, Oscar was immersed in the world of "Lucha Libre," Mexico's rich and storied tradition of professional wrestling that combines athleticism, artistry, and a touch of folkloric spectacle. His family ties played a significant role in this upbringing as his uncle, Rey Mysterio Sr., a legendary luchador in his own right, would often train and mentor the young Oscar in the art of wrestling. From a young age, Oscar demonstrated a natural flair for the sport, quickly mastering the technical skills required to succeed in the world of Lucha Libre. His dedication and passion for the craft were evident, and his uncle saw great potential in the young Oscar, recognizing the family legacy he could carry forward. As Oscar's skills continued to improve, he began to take part in local matches and events, gradually building a reputation as a formidable and thrilling young wrestler. His uncle's guidance was invaluable, providing not only technical expertise but also valuable lessons about sportsmanship, pride, and the importance of staying true to one's roots.
